这篇为理论篇,稍后会有实践篇 1、分片集群是个啥玩意儿 要回答这个问题,首先得知道它是由什么东东组成的。 MongoDB分片集群由以下组件组成: mongos:mongos作为查询路由器,提供客户端应用程序和分片集群之间的接口。 配置服务器:配置服务器存储集群的元数据和配置信息。从MongoDB 3 ...
分类:
其他好文 时间:
2017-10-28 12:56:50
阅读次数:
133
环境: windows操作系统 mongodb 3.4社区版 目标: 配置包含两个分片一个配置服务器的分片集群。其中每一个分片和一个配置服务器都被配置为一个单独的副本集。如下图所示: 注:每一个分片都应该被配置在一个单独的服务器设备上。方便起见,本文在同一台机器通过不同端口模拟不同服务器上的组件,实 ...
分类:
数据库 时间:
2017-09-06 23:49:47
阅读次数:
321
1,监控插件下载Mongodb插件下载地址为:git clone git://github.com/mzupan/nagios-plugin-mongodb.git,刚開始本人这里没有安装gitpub环境,找网友草根帮忙下载的。之后上传到了csdn资源页面,新的下载地址为:http://downlo ...
分类:
移动开发 时间:
2017-08-16 09:53:45
阅读次数:
237
1. 测试工具 本次测试选取YCSB(Yahoo! Cloud System Benchmark)作为测试客户端工具。YCSB是Yahoo开源的一个nosql测试工具,用来测试比较各种nosql的性能,项目地址:https://github.com/brianfrankcooper/YCSB。项目的 ...
分类:
数据库 时间:
2017-05-12 17:22:30
阅读次数:
194
操作系统:CentOS6x86_64MongoDB版本:3.4.3集群主机拓扑:主机mongoshardsvr&ReplSetNamemongoconfigsvr&ReplSetNamemongostest1.lanshard-ashard-btest2.lanshard-ashard-btest3.lanshard-ashard-btest4.lancfgshardtest5.lancfgshardtest6.lancfgshardtest7.lanyest..
分类:
数据库 时间:
2017-04-25 10:08:52
阅读次数:
476
--创建配置服务器mongod.exe --logpath "G:\USERDATA\MONGODB\Test2\Log\mongodb.log" --logappend --dbpath "G:\USERDATA\MONGODB\Test2\DB" --port 27031 --serviceNa ...
分类:
数据库 时间:
2016-10-20 09:56:01
阅读次数:
183
分片在Mongodb里面存在另一种集群,就是分片技术,可以满足MongoDB数据量大量增长的需求。当MongoDB存储海量的数据时,一台机器可能不足以存储数据,也可能不足以提供可接受的读写吞吐量。这时,我们就可以通过在多台机器上分割数据,使得数据库系统能存储和处理更多的数据。 为什么使用分片? 1. ...
分类:
数据库 时间:
2016-08-15 22:10:04
阅读次数:
480
从mongodb 3.0开始,mongorestore还原的时候,需要一个运行着的实例。早期的版本没有这个要求。 1.为每个分片部署一个复制集 (1)复制集中的每个成员启动一个mongod (2)通过mongo连接到实例,运行: 2.部署config服务器 3.启动mongos实例 4.集群添加分片 ...
分类:
数据库 时间:
2016-04-29 14:41:16
阅读次数:
663
三台机器操作系统环境如下:[mongodb@node1~]$cat/etc/issue
CentOSrelease6.4(Final)
Kernel\ronan\m
[mongodb@node1~]$uname-r
2.6.32-358.el6.x86_64
[mongodb@node1~]$uname-m
x86_64架构如下图,之前的架构图找不到了,就凑合看下面的表格吧。。192.168.75.128、shard1:10..
分类:
数据库 时间:
2016-03-09 11:09:25
阅读次数:
305
mkdir/usr/local/mongodb/etcmkdir/usr/local/mongodb/datamkdir/usr/local/mongodb/logsmkdir/usr/local/mongodb/pid1、安装软件tarzxvfmongodb-linux-x86_64-rhel62-3.0.2.tgz&&mvmongodb-linux-x86_64-rhel62-3.0.2/*/usr/local/mongodb/2、创建mongodb数据实例配置..
分类:
数据库 时间:
2016-02-11 06:49:59
阅读次数:
270